Qué onda is a cool Spanish phrase you can use to say “what’s up” or ask “what’s going on.” Although originally Mexican, qué onda is widely understood in most Spanish-speaking countries. When you’re blown away by something cool you can show your enthusiasm and disbelief with a ¡No manches! This catchy Spanish phrase is used for when people are in awe, surprised, or speechless.
